Choosing between Chanty and Spike is a common decision for team communication buyers in 2026. Both Chanty and Spike are established players, founded in 2017 and 2014 respectively. Chanty serves 50K+ users while Spike has 1M+ users globally. Chanty differentiates with messaging and task management, while Spike leads with conversational email and group chat. Both Chanty and Spike offer free plans, lowering the barrier to entry. Chanty's paid plans start at $3/user/mo while Spike begins at $5/user/mo. Evaluate which paid features — Video calls, Voice messages (Chanty) vs Video calls, Collaborative notes (Spike) — justify upgrading for your team.
Bottom line: Choose Chanty if you need small teams wanting affordable, simple team chat. Go with Spike if your priority is teams wanting chat-style communication without leaving their email inbox.
